This past June, the National Cowgirl Museum and Hall of Fame announced four inductees who will be honored at the 48th annual induction luncheon and ceremony on Nov. 12 in Fort Worth, Texas.

“Every year, we are in awe of the talent and tenacity that our honorees possess, and the 2024 Inductees are no exception,” said museum executive director Patricia Riley in a statement. “Each of them has made impactful contributions to their respective fields, and we are honored for them to join the Cowgirl family.”

Among this year’s inductees is Canadian saddle bronc rider Kaila Mussell. The three other inductees include Ariat co-founder Beth Cross, 18-time Women’s Pro Rodeo Association world champion roper JJ Hampton, and the Pack Horse Library Project.
